The support forum for GE has a couple of notes that may apply. The free
version of GE should not ask for a login and password. If you had previously
downloaded Keyhole (which is the engine behind GE), it will ask for your
email address and password. I know it did for me... and puzzled me for a
minute. I don't think it's validating against your email account. I think I
used a different password from my email account for Keyhole, and entered
that password when starting GE.

Does this fit your situation? Did you try Keyhole before?
